Dali RestaurantDali Restaurant Review – Simply put, this Spanish tapas bar is sexy. Dalí captures the seductive passion of Barcelona, and like its namesake (Salvador Dalí), is infused with a romantic surrealism aimed to shatter life’s daily dullness. Walk through the wooden doors of this blue shingled eatery and enter a festive party with an atmosphere of pure sensuality. A glowing copper ceiling, elaborately tiled tables, and walls packed with Iberian art and trinkets create the feeling of a mysterious gypsy lair. Spirited Spanish waiters roll their r’s as they bring sherry and sangria, and explain Dalí’s over 40 exotic tapas offerings. Diners flirt while sharing their small plates, and beaded curtains create corner alcoves for those seeking more privacy (last year there were over 15 marriage proposals in this magical bistro). Delicious tapas selections include Chipirones Rellenos – stuffed squid in its own ink; Gambas Con Gabardina – saffron-batter fried shrimp with mojo sauce; and Butifarras Con Brevas – pork sausage with figs. Excellent main courses include their mouthwatering Pescado a la Sal – tenderized sea bass baked in coarse salt (the fish arrives tableside in a block of salt which is dramatically smashed by your waiter). For dessert, try the amazing fruit-filled dessert crepe with chocolate sauce and orange liquor. For an exciting restaurant experience that arouses all the senses, Dalí delivers.
